We are seeking an experienced Data Architect to join a major transformation programme within a leading Housing Association. This is an exciting opportunity for a seasoned data professional to play a key advisory and architectural role across enterprise-wide change initiatives. The successful candidate will bring strong experience in classic architecture services, enterprise data governance, data modelling, and transformation delivery, ideally within the Housing Association or Social Housing sector.

Key Experience Required

  • Strong background as a Data Architect within large-scale transformation environments
  • Previous experience working within a Housing Association / Social Housing organisation
  • Deep understanding of how data operates within Housing Associations
  • Data Governance frameworks
  • Data Migration strategies
  • Data Architecture advisory within change programmes
  • Transformation and organisational change initiatives
  • Experience acting as a design authority within complex programmes
  • Ability to balance strategic architecture with practical delivery

Key Responsibilities

  • Shape and assure enterprise data architecture outcomes across the organisation
  • Define and maintain data architecture principles, standards, and patterns
  • Own and steward the enterprise data model as a core corporate asset
  • Maintain data standards, entities, attributes, relationships, business glossary, and data dictionary
  • Support integration, analytics, reporting, governance, and AI-related data initiatives
  • Act as the Data Design Authority across programmes and projects
  • Provide architectural assurance and constructive challenge within change delivery
  • Collaborate with engineering and delivery teams to ensure scalable and sustainable solutions
  • Promote strong data governance, metadata, lineage, and quality practices
  • Support architecture maturity and embed architectural best practice across the organisation

Experience within regulated environments. Understanding of data retention and compliance requirements. Exposure to enterprise architecture tooling and repositories. Strong stakeholder engagement and advisory capability.
